Given two binary trees, write a function to check if they are equal or not.
Two binary trees are considered equal if they are structurally identical and the nodes have the same value.
/**
* Definition for a binary tree node.
* public class TreeNode {
* public var val: Int
* public var left: TreeNode?
* public var right: TreeNode?
* public init(_ val: Int) {
* self.val = val
* self.left = nil
* self.right = nil
* }
* }
*/
class Solution {
func isSameTree(_ p: TreeNode?, _ q: TreeNode?) -> Bool {
guard let pp = p, let qq = q else { return p == nil && q == nil }
guard pp.val == qq.val else { return false }
return isSameTree(pp.left, qq.left) && isSameTree(pp.right, qq.right)
}
}
